(S) Charge spoke to Secretary General of the Presidency (and former Deputy Foreign Minister) Bernardino Leon on November 23 to convey reftel points. Leon, President Zapatero's closest foreign policy advisor, who was in the Middle East on travel with Zapatero, said that Spain was committed to doing more on Afghanistan and that he would outline specific details in a telephone conversation later in the day with NSA General Jones. Leon said that Spanish contributions were likely to include a significant increase in Civil Guard police trainers and some additional military personnel, although specific numbers would be defined in the coming days. ¶2. (U) Since the Zapatero administration allowed its self-imposed, 3000-troop cap for overseas deployments to expire at the end of 2008, there are no fixed numbers that determine Spain's ability to contribute military or civil guard forces. In the past, the Spanish MOD has conducted internal assessments that determined its capability for deployments outside the country, given current staffing, would be about 7000 troops, if unlimited funding were available and if congressional authorization could be obtained. Under Spanish law, the MOD obtains congressional authorization for all its deployments and troop levels, along with the budget allocation oversight exercised by the Spanish Congress. ¶3. (S) In addition to Post's wide dissemination of the Afghanistan strategy to key players here in Madrid, we understand that NSA General Jones did speak to Leon via VTC in Jeddah, Saudi Arabia, Secretary Clinton plans to call Foreign Minister Moratinos, and the U.S. Office of the Under Secretary for Defense Policy will call Spanish MOD Director General for Defense Policy Luis Cuesta to reinforce Afghanistan mission needs and next steps. ¶4. (S) Leon agreed to meet with Charge on his return to Spain, most likely during the week of December 2, to follow-up on their Afghanistan discussions. Post will seek more specifics regarding Spain's planned contributions during that session. CHACON
